The Importance of Prayer

Prayer, or Salah, is one of the fundamental pillars of Islam, connecting believers with Allah throughout the day. In Waldron, its essential to be aware of the timings for each prayer to ensure that you can perform them properly. Heres a brief overview of the five daily prayers

Fajr in Waldron
Fajr is the first prayer of the day, performed at dawn before sunrise. It serves as a peaceful and reflective time to start the day, allowing worshippers to connect with their spirituality early in the morning.

Sunrise in Waldron
The time of sunrise marks a moment of beauty and the dawning of a new day. While the Fajr prayer is completed before this time, witnessing the sunrise can be a moment of meditation and gratitude.

Dhuhr in Waldron
Dhuhr is the second prayer of the day, performed after the sun has passed its zenith. This midday prayer encourages a brief pause in daily activities to refocus on spiritual commitments and responsibilities.

Asr in Waldron
The Asr prayer is the afternoon prayer, observed when the shadow of an object is equal to its length. This prayer is a reminder of the passing day and an opportunity to reflect and seek guidance from Allah during lifes busyness.

Maghrib in Waldron
Maghrib is the evening prayer, performed just after sunset. This prayer symbolizes the transition from day to night and serves as a moment of gratitude for the days blessings and experiences.

Isha in Waldron
Isha is the final prayer of the day, performed after twilight has disappeared. It offers a moment to seek forgiveness and peace before concluding the day, allowing for reflection on the days events and setting intentions for the following day.
